21st Century Skills: Higher Order Thinking – Math
Lesson Overview
After thoroughly learning about and understanding division of fractions, students developed a way to explain & demonstrate division of fractions to their peers.
21st Century Skill
HOTS – Higher Order Thinking – Structuring the classroom environment so that students feel comfortable using HOTS to explore topics is imperative. It does not have to take a lot of planning, it can be something that is developed through higher level questioning and discussion skills that can happen during those “teachable” moments. Because they are using HOTS, their understanding of topics and the curriculum is broader and deeper, which results in increased academic achievement.
